Having ploughed a furrow (probably quite literally given the state of the pitch in the torrential rain) up and down the left flank and receiving very little attention -apart from the BBC’s Mark Bright who was virtually screaming at the Turkey side to pass him the ball – Arda Turan eventually got his just desserts by bagging himself the winner against Switzerland. His Castrol Index heat map shows that he was heavily involved in everything in and around the left corner of the penalty area, and it was no surprise that this is where he scored his – albeit fortunately deflected – winner.

Turkey’s manager Fatih Terim might want to instil in his players the need to get the match won in normal time, with good reason. The Czechs (in their many guises, well, as Czechoslovakia) haven’t lost a penalty shoot out in the Euros in all three attempts. If tonight’s game finishes level, then penalties in the group stage are looming, and that prospect should fill the Turks with dread. See below for details.
